Isaac Doolittle, of New-Haven, having erected a suitable
building, and prepared an apparatus convenient for Bell-
Founding, and having had good success in his first attempt,
intends to carry out that business, and will supply any that
please to employ him, with any size bell commonly us'd in
this, or the neighbouring provinces, on reasonable terms.
Said Doolittle pays cash for old copper.
